THOMAS GETS HIS THOMSON TWINS? NEW PARTNER IDENTIFIED

          Peter and David Thomson, sons of Canadian "media baron"
     Ken Thomson, are a "key component" of the consortium Raptors
     VP Isiah Thomas has put together to buy the team from Owner
     Allan Slaight, according to Craig Daniels of the TORONTO
     SUN.  However, Daniels writes, "a source said it appears the
     Thomsons want to be involved only if a way can be found to
     unite the Maple Leafs and Raptors and solve the arena wars. 
     One source said that the Teachers' Pension Plan, part-owners
     of Maple Leaf Gardens, seeks the same arrangement, and would
     view a Thomson-led group favorably."  But "it appears the
     board at Maple Leaf Gardens may not be united in that aim." 
     If the Raptors and Maple Leafs joined on a facility, the
     Thomsons would give the teams "the financial wherewithal" to
     be competitive in the marketplace.  Daniels adds that
     sources also "suggested yesterday that if the sale to Thomas
     did not go through, Slaight would offer the team" to MLG
     Minority Owner Larry Tanenbaum (TORONTO SUN, 7/31).
